ABOUT SELVA NOCTURNA The sextet around Antonio Cosenza from Hamburg gives jazz a real pearl of looseness with their third album. That there is so much Latin flair in the album is of course due to the fact that the roots of some musicians come from Cuba, Guatemala and Argentina. Whether it's a racy or a quiet composition of their own, the harmonious coexistence between all the different string and wind instruments is striking, while still leaving enough room for solos.
